Asphalt Lot Paving in Little Rock, AR
Asphalt lot paving services involve the installation, repair, and resurfacing of asphalt surfaces used for driveways, parking lots, and other outdoor areas. These projects typically include preparing the ground, laying fresh asphalt, and ensuring a smooth, durable surface that can withstand daily traffic and weather conditions. Homeowners often request asphalt paving to create a functional and attractive parking area, improve existing surfaces, or replace worn-out pavement to enhance curb appeal and property value.
Property owners should consider factors such as the size of the area, the current condition of the existing surface, and any permits or regulations that may apply before requesting asphalt paving services. Understanding the scope of work, material options, and maintenance requirements can help ensure the project meets long-term needs. Consulting with paving professionals can provide guidance on the best approach for specific property features and usage expectations.

Common Asphalt Lot Paving Jobs
Parking Lot Paving - durable surfaces designed to accommodate vehicle traffic on commercial and residential properties.
Driveway Resurfacing - restoring existing asphalt driveways to improve appearance and functionality.
New Asphalt Installations - laying fresh asphalt for driveways, pathways, or parking areas.
Patchwork and Repairs - fixing potholes, cracks, and surface damage to extend asphalt lifespan.
Sealcoating Services - applying protective coatings to prevent weather damage and maintain asphalt quality.
Overlay Projects - adding a new asphalt layer over existing surfaces for a smoother, longer-lasting finish.
Asphalt Lot Paving Questions
What types of asphalt paving projects are common for residential properties? Typical projects include driveways, parking areas, and walkways to improve accessibility and curb appeal.
How long does asphalt paving usually last on a property? With proper maintenance, asphalt surfaces generally last 15 to 20 years.
What should property owners consider before paving an asphalt lot? It's important to evaluate the lot's size, drainage, and existing surface conditions for the best results.
Is asphalt paving suitable for small or large property projects? Asphalt paving can be adapted to both small residential driveways and larger commercial parking lots.
